In today's competitive packaging industry, product appearance plays a critical role in attracting consumer attention and strengthening brand recognition. Shrink sleeve labels have become a popular packaging solution because they provide nearly full-container coverage and support creative package designs. However, the final appearance of a shrink sleeve label depends heavily on the performance of the shrink sleeve tunnel used during production.
Selecting the right shrink sleeve tunnel is an important decision that can influence packaging quality, operational efficiency, and production flexibility. Manufacturers should evaluate several key factors before integrating a shrink tunnel into their packaging operations.
Start with Your Packaging Requirements
Every production facility has unique packaging needs. Container materials, bottle shapes, label designs, and production volumes all influence the type of shrink sleeve tunnel best suited for the application.
A tunnel that performs well with standard cylindrical bottles may not deliver the same results on containers with curves, shoulders, or complex contours. Understanding the characteristics of the products being packaged is the first step toward making an effective equipment selection.
Matching equipment capabilities to actual production requirements helps avoid performance limitations in the future.
Evaluate Label Appearance Expectations
For many consumer products, packaging serves as a direct representation of brand quality. Uneven shrinking, wrinkles, or distortion can negatively affect shelf appeal and customer perception.
When choosing a shrink sleeve tunnel, manufacturers should consider how consistently the system can produce smooth and uniform label results. Different packaging formats may require different heat application methods to achieve optimal sleeve conformity.
Focusing on label presentation helps ensure that packaging supports marketing and branding objectives.
Consider Production Speed and Workflow Balance
Packaging lines operate most efficiently when all stages of production work together without interruption. A shrink sleeve tunnel should be capable of supporting overall line performance without creating bottlenecks.
Rather than concentrating solely on maximum operating speed, manufacturers should evaluate how well the tunnel integrates with upstream and downstream equipment. Consistent throughput often delivers greater operational benefits than occasional peak performance.
Balanced production flow contributes to higher productivity and more predictable output.
Flexibility Supports Product Diversification
Consumer markets continue to evolve, leading manufacturers to introduce new packaging designs and product variations more frequently than ever before.
A flexible shrink sleeve tunnel can support different container sizes, label materials, and production requirements with minimal disruption. This adaptability becomes particularly valuable for companies managing multiple product categories or seasonal packaging updates.
Flexible equipment helps manufacturers respond more effectively to changing market demands.
Pay Attention to Process Control
Packaging consistency depends on maintaining stable operating conditions throughout production. Effective process control allows manufacturers to achieve repeatable results across large production volumes.
Modern shrink sleeve tunnel systems increasingly incorporate advanced monitoring and adjustment capabilities that help maintain consistent shrink performance. Reliable process control can reduce packaging defects and improve overall production efficiency.
Consistency remains one of the most important indicators of packaging system performance.
Assess Long-Term Operational Value
Equipment investments should be evaluated from a long-term perspective rather than focusing exclusively on immediate production needs. Factors such as reliability, adaptability, maintenance requirements, and future expansion potential all contribute to overall operational value.
A shrink sleeve tunnel that supports years of stable operation while accommodating changing packaging requirements can provide significant benefits throughout its service life.
Long-term planning often results in more sustainable production growth and improved return on investment.
